Abstract

PROBLEM TO BE SOLVED: To provide baskets which can be kept for storage in a condition where one basket is fitting inside of another when there is nothing to be stored therein, can be stacked in a stable condition even when there is an item stored therein, and which are provided with a handle for conveniently carrying the same. SOLUTION: On the main body 1 of a storage basket, a pair of handles 2, 2 are mounted rotatively. The position of the holding part 21 of the handles 2, 2 when they are knocked down outwardly can be moved to the inside or the outside of the opening of the basket for utilizing the handles as a supporting member in placing another storage basket shaped identically thereon.

B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a storage car having a peripheral side wall that widens toward an upper opening.

2. Description of the Related Art A storage car having a peripheral side wall that expands toward an upper opening is compact by stacking the car bodies in a nesting state in multiple stages when there are no articles to be stored. There is an advantage that it can be stored easily.

However, when articles are stacked in a state where they are stored, the stored articles push up the bottom wall of the storage basket placed on top of them, so that stability is lost and the articles themselves may be damaged.

In order to eliminate such inconvenience, as shown in FIG. 12, a pair of substantially U-shaped support members 9 and 9 are rotatably attached to both ends of the side walls 81 and 81 of the storage car body 8 facing each other. A storage basket is available on the market. This can be carried out in the conventional nesting manner by tilting both supporting members 9 and 9 outward so that the lateral rods 91 and 91 of the supporting members 9 are outside the peripheral edge of the opening of the storage car body 8. Moreover, if the supporting members 9, 9 are turned inward and the horizontal rod portions 91, 91 are bridged in parallel between the upper end edges of the front and rear side walls 81, 81, another same-shaped storage basket can be placed thereon. It can be placed. If there are stored items, the latter method can prevent push-up and can stack them stably.

However, the storage basket to which the support member is attached has the following new drawbacks due to the introduction of the support member.

First, Since the arm portions 92, 92 of the support member are reversed and the lateral rod portion 91 is thereby moved in and out of the opening, the dimensions of the arm portions 92, 92 must be shortened. Therefore, it is very inconvenient to use the supporting member 9 as a handle when carrying it, and it is difficult to hold the supporting member 9 and it is not possible to collectively grasp both the lateral rod portions 91, 91 with one hand.

Secondly. However, if the handle is attached separately, the cost will increase.

The present invention has been made in view of the actual situation of such a conventional storage basket, and its purpose is to enable stacking storage in a nested state when there is no storage product, and to store the storage product. The purpose is to provide a storage basket that can be stably stacked in multiple layers without damaging it and that is easy to carry at a low cost.
